At BWX Technologies, Inc. (NYSE: BWXT), we are People Strong, Innovation Driven. A U.S.-based company, BWXT is a Fortune 1000 and Defense News Top 100 manufacturing and engineering innovator that provides safe and effective nuclear solutions for global security, clean energy, environmental restoration, nuclear medicine and space exploration. With more than 7,800 employees, BWXT has 14 major operating sites in the U.S., Canada and the U.K. We are the sole manufacturer of naval nuclear reactors for U.S. submarines and aircraft carriers. Our company supplies precision manufactured components, services and fuel for the commercial nuclear power industry across four continents. Our joint ventures provide environmental restoration and operations management at a dozen U.S. Department of Energy and NASA facilities. BWXT’s technology is driving advances in medical radioisotope production in North America and microreactors for various defense and space applications. For more information, visit www.bwxt.com. Welding Engineering Unit Manager  -  BWX Technologies, Inc.  -  Barberton, Ohio

 

The Weld Engineering Unit Manager leads a diverse team of welding engineers, technicians, and specialists within the Welding Engineering department, ensuring alignment with company and customer objectives related to the fabrication of NOG components. This role is responsible for managing staffing, welding processes, quality, safety, schedule, and cost to achieve high-quality weld fabrication.This supervisory role requires collaboration across departments to optimize weld process efficiency, reduce defects, and support future welding technology initiatives. 

 

Responsibilities may include, but are not limited to:

 

  • Responsible for leading a diverse group of welding engineers, technicians and other specialists within the Welding Engineering (W.E.) department to achieve all company and customer commitments as related to the fabrication of NOG components. Responsible for ensuring the W.E. unit is properly aligned and supportive of all company objectives as it relates to the development, staffing, execution and overall quality of the weld process and associated operations. This alignment includes all aspects of Safety, Quality, Schedule and Cost associated with the weld process.  
  • Coordinates and controls welding engineers’ job functions to provide uniform, coordinated direction of the company’s short and long range goals.
  • Assures staffing levels to support administrative and shop management needs including personnel proposal, requisitioning, interviewing and hiring activities.
  • Works collaboratively and takes the lead in assuring welding equipment and welding cells can be operated in a safe manner free of injury.
  • Reviews engineering drawings to assure they provide for economic fabrication of highest quality.
  • Works within and outside department to pre-plan future needs to assure the timeliness of equipment, weld development, weld and welder qualifications, training, execution, testing and any other aspect of the job associated with the weld overall process.   
  • Assures technical welding engineering support for shop welding surveillance for all welding processes.
  • Works collaboratively with other departments, as required, to identify funding needs, constraints, equipment/parameter problems for assuring the timely completion of the weld process relative to the overall schedule needs.
  • Works collaboratively with Operations to define the weld process capability, weld process robustness and weld process limitations to establish expectations associated with the efficient deposition of the weld, while achieving first time quality.
  • Works to decrease (or “improve”) weld and associated non-weld repair rates through an active and collaborative management style.
  • Works within W.E. unit and department to specify welding processes and procedures to be employed through preparation of weld data sheets in accordance with contract requirements.
  • Initiates welding procedure qualifications to support contract requirements.
  • Evaluates welding performance through analysis of the Weld Defect Report.  Initiates necessary corrective actions after considering economic, scheduler and quality impact.
  • Responds to shop welding and welding metallurgical problems to effectively resolve the problem and yet maintain work within contractual obligations and corporate commitments.
  • Identifies areas for improving overall weld operation efficiency through a collaborative understanding of the equipment, set-up, personnel, training and weld process capabilities vs the weld process robustness to assure first time quality.
  • Provides technical justification for DSRs (Degradation of Specification Reports) and RARs (Repair Approval Requests) on all contracts.
  • Identifies the risks associated within the contract and within shop operations associated with welding and works collaboratively to resolve concerns.  
  • Coordinates and supports proposal activities to assure all aspects of Safety, Quality, Schedule and Cost can be achieved and a gap analysis with guidance where risks exist.
  • Organizes and supports the preparation of technical weld related comments to documents referenced in proposals.
  • Participates in negotiations, as required, with customer to facilitate fair and equitable solutions assuring schedule, technical and price commitments are achievable and have the appropriate risks identified and accounted for.
  • Establishes, analyzes, and negotiates programs or technical changes that result from customer inquiries or internal recommendations.
  • Works within department and with associated departments to establish weld wire needs, quantities and special qualification requirements for individual proposals and overall NOG Contracts.
  • Negotiates welding related technical requirements at proposal state and throughout contract term.
  • Resolves customer concerns with respect to procedure qualifications and weld data sheets.
  • Initiates actions for fabrication and testing of welding procedure qualifications.
  • Interprets the requirements of NAVSEA 250-1500-1, ASME Boiler and Pressure Vessel Code, and customer specifications related to welding to assure that all fabrication meets contract requirements.
  • Participates in Planning and evaluating welding research and development related to future program initiatives and manages customer workscopes that apply to future welding technology.
